Headache For Arsenal As Iwobi Reveals Bandaged Foot

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ger faces more worrying times as Nigerian super star Alex Iwobi reveald a bandaged foot following the FA Cup win at Sutton United on Monday.

Iwobi was caught by a hefty challenge in the first half from Sutton captain Jamie Collins but stayed on until the second half.

Iwobi later posted a picture on social media of what appeared to be his leg wrapped in a bandage.

Sutton skipper Jamie Collins went through Iwobi after winning the ball with a thunderous challenge towards the end of the first half at Gander Green Lane.

But the Nigeria international managed to play on and kept going until being eventually being replaced by Alexis Sanchez for the final 15 minutes.

Goals from Lucas Perez and Theo Walcott secured Arsenal passage into the quater finals of the FA Cup. The Gunners will now face another non-league team Licoln City for the race to Wembley.
